Rice global gene expression profile in response to plant hormones


ABSTRACT: A time course gene expression profiling of rice treated with various plant hormones (abscisic acid, gibberelin, auxin, brassinosteroid, cytokinin and jasmonic acid) was performed to obtain an overall signature of the rice transcriptome in response to each phytohormone. The transcriptome of rice seedlings treated with various plant hormones such as abscisic acid (ABA), gibberellic acid 3 (GA3), indole-3-acetic acid (IAA), brassinolide (BL), trans-zeatin (tZ), and jasmonic acid (JA) was characterized by microarray analysis. Seven-day old seedlings were transferred in culture solutions with specific hormones and in culture solution without hormone to serve as control (mock treatment). Root samples were collected and analyzed in three replicates at pretreatment (control) and after 15 min, 30 min, 1 h, 3 h and 6 h incubation in culture solutions with each hormone. Shoot samples were collected and analyzed in two replicates at pretreatment (control) and after 1 h, 3 h, 6 h and 12 h incubation culture solutions with each hormone. A total of 93 microarray data for root and 50 microarray data for shoot were obtained.

ORGANISM(S): Oryza sativa Japonica Group

RiceFREND: a platform for retrieving coexpressed gene networks in rice.

Sato Yutaka Y   Namiki Nobukazu N   Takehisa Hinako H   Kamatsuki Kaori K   Minami Hiroshi H   Ikawa Hiroshi H   Ohyanagi Hajime H   Sugimoto Kazuhiko K   Itoh Jun-Ichi J   Antonio Baltazar A BA   Nagamura Yoshiaki Y  

Nucleic acids research 20121124 Database issue


Similarity of gene expression across a wide range of biological conditions can be efficiently used in characterization of gene function. We have constructed a rice gene coexpression database, RiceFREND (http://ricefrend.dna.affrc.go.jp/), to identify gene modules with similar expression profiles and provide a platform for more accurate prediction of gene functions.
